Scope:

Research in post-silicon electronics is moving toward to cheaper, and more versatile , flexible, functional and/or efficient organic and molecules materials applicable to electronic devices. This symposium session covers various aspect of materials research related to organic and molecular electronics. The applications extend to such fields as transistors, displays, photovoltaics, optical devices, energy devices, sensors, and bioelectronics etc. The topics related to basic physics and chemistry, material development, thin film process technologies, devices and applications are covered in this symposium.

Topics:

The main topics of this symposium are as follows, but not limited to fundamental and applied researches on organic materials:

1. Materials Properties: Electric, Electronic, and Optical Properties
2. Thin Film Technology: Flexible, Printed and/or Dissolvable Thin Films
3. Organic Semiconductors: Materials and Devices
4. Nobel Organic Light-Emitting Diodes (OLEDs) and Liquid Crystals
5. Organic Photovoltaic Materials and Devices
6. Sensing or Bioelectronics Materials and Devices
7. Inorganic–Organic Hybrid Materials and Applications
